Hi,

Is it possible to search in a array from bottom cell to top cell (Vlookup does from top to bottom), In the below table I need a result of "Shaft" for input 3, whereas vlookup will give "Crank shaft" as a result

LevelPart
1Truck
2Engine
3Crank Shaft
3Cam Shaft
3Cylinder
4Piston
4Piston Rod
2Transmission
3Gears
3Case
3Shaft

Assumed your data in ranges A1:B12, based on your table, and input criteria in Cell D2 (ie: 3)
Put this in Cell in E2 and copied down:

=INDEX(B:B,MAX((A2:A12=D2)*ROW(A2:A12)))

Array Formula --> hit CTRL-SHIFT-ENTER button together
